Protesters Denounce 'Forced Disappearances' In Pakistan's Tribal Region
Your browser doesn’t support HTML5
Huge crowds gathered for a rally in the Pakistan's Pashtun-dominated tribal region on April 14 to denounce what they said were human rights abuses and "enforced disappearances" by state security forces.